amerifax wrote:
1. I have been able to add the program but I still need to know how to add a folder.


Just drag the folder you want from an Explorer window and drop it into the 'Quick Launch' section of the NextSTART taskbar.

amerifax wrote:
2. I came across "icon customization list" and I'm not sure to the benefit.


You mean the 'Customize Task Icons' list?

This allows you to change the icon displayed in the taskbar for a running program. You see, in previous Windows versions the icon used in the taskbar was provided by the actual window (under Windows 7 the icon used to display a running application is the *application* icon), and this icon was usually 16x16 pixels in size (remember Windows XP? The icons in taskbar buttons were always 16x16 icons).

Because the NextSTART taskbar was always able to display taskbar icons in sizes larger than this, the small 16x16 icon would end up being enlarged, which made it look blurry and/or bulky. To compensate for this, the user could make NextSTART replace the original icons with larger, high resolution, icons of his choice.

As for the Task Exclusion list, it does what it says: it prevents some applications - or specific windows from an application - from appearing in the tasklist, even if they are currently running. This allows you to do things such as prevent an application that is always running in your system (and always accessible) from taking up space in the tasklist.
